Ordinals
beta
Sat 1580747603555018
decimal
53476.18803555018
percentile
3.161495207110036%
name
mdytwvauzlnz
cycle
0
epoch
2
block
53476
offset
18803555018
timestamp
2024-02-17 19:30:12 UTC
rarity
common
prev
next